Output 71289ac285df933fd5a8bc466924ef1082be72da39b0922b05e03c0d7470225a:7

value
366494310
script pubkey
OP_0 OP_PUSHBYTES_20 d16e510bc39c3d36d05346bed1c84c0b0b6d17e5
address
bc1q69h9zz7rns7nd5zng6ldrjzvpv9k69l9f5f30x
transaction
71289ac285df933fd5a8bc466924ef1082be72da39b0922b05e03c0d7470225a
confirmations
120698
spent
true